This striking mural was created by artist Thomas Readett in collaboration with the Kaurna Yerta Aboriginal Corporation (KYAC).

Guided by KYAC’s design brief, the artwork reflects themes of duality, dusk and dawn, night and day, people and fauna, all existing together in harmony across the two walls of the overpass.

At its centre is a portrait of Ipparityi (Ivaritji), a legendary Kaurna woman born in 1849. She was a skilled weaver and a strong figure in Kaurna history, remembered for her resilience and cultural leadership.

  • Location: Junction Creek Overpass, Onkaparinga Valley Road, Balhannah
  • Artist: Thomas Readett (TR Visual Art)
  • Commissioned by: SA Department for Infrastructure and Transport

About the Artist

Thomas Readett is a Ngarrindjeri man, born and raised on Kaurna Country (Adelaide, SA), where he continues to live and work. His practice spans drawing, painting, video, music, advocacy, and education, with a strong focus on storytelling and cultural representation.

Where to See It

The mural can be best viewed from Brockhoff Park near Balhannah Oval, where it adorns the walls of the Junction Creek Overpass on Onkaparinga Valley Road, Balhannah.
